You do not always have to strip it apart, I have had a lot of success simply opening the rear and putting a few drops of light oil in the cup, and gently blowing it into the bushing with a rubber dropper bottle rear to apply pressure. Works well for those miniature ball bearing fans to get new lubrication past the dust shields and into the bearing itself. You just have to apply a few cycles to get oil past the first one and into the inner one as well, so it too will be quiet.
